Splet09. mar. 2024 · 9 March 2024 Construction businesses using the Construction Industry Scheme (CIS) need to deduct money from a subcontractor’s payments. These payments go to HMRC as part of the subcontractor’s tax and National Insurance obligations.

CIS is the construction industry scheme, and CIS payroll refers to the processing of payment from contractors to subcontractors under the scheme.
